The U.S.-Mexico border has become a "battlefield" in the war between rival Mexican drug cartels and a beleaguered Mexican government, according to one Texas law enforcement official. And the state's governor, Rick Perry, says the U.S. government must do more quickly to "stabilize" the border before even more of Mexico's spreading bloodshed spills north. Texas shares a 1, 254-mile border with Mexico.
